Rice
is low in fat, salt and has no cholesterol:
Being low in fat, rice is suitable
to include in a diet for those watching
their weight. Rice is also cholesterol
free, therefore being an excellent
food to include in a cholesterol
lowering diet. Brown rice contains
a small amount of rice bran oil.
Rice
is gluten free:
Some
people are unable to tolerate the
proteins found in wheat, barley,
rye, oats. These people choose foods
that are gluten free. All rice is
gluten free, making rice the essential
choice for people with gluten free
dietary requirements.
Rice
contains no additives or preservatives:
Rice
contains no additives or preservatives,
making it an excellent inclusion
in a healthy and balanced diet.
Rice also contains resistant starch,
which is the starch that reaches
the bowel undigested. This encourages
the growth of beneficial bacteria,
keeping the bowel healthy.
